#b5b68c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b5b68c is composed of 71% red, 71.4% green and 54.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 23.1% yellow and 28.6% black. It has a hue angle of 61.4 degrees, a saturation of 22.3% and a lightness of 63.1%. #b5b68c color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#6b6d19. Closest websafe color is: #cccc99.

#b5b68c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b5b68c has RGB values of R:181, G:182, B:140 and CMYK values of C:0.01, M:0, Y:0.23, K:0.29. Its decimal value is 11908748.
